What is marble?

 

Marble is a type of metamorphic rock derived from the recrystallization of sedimentary limestone exposed to immense heat and pressure. This process occurs to limestone deep within the earth and is associated with tectonic activity. Differences in the duration, heat, pressure, and other impurities present during metamorphism can lead to differences in the marble type produced at the structural and chemical level. Marble is primarily composed of calcium carbonate that is both structurally homogenous and fine grained, and usually contains other additional chemical impurities (e.g., metal oxides, silicates). These impurities can lead the naturally pure white marble to gain unique patterning (e.g., veins, branches) and overall color variations across the color spectrum.

 

In what ways do people utilize marble?

 

Marble can be found throughout the globe, is accessed typically through mining and is utilized as both a dimensioned stone and as an aggregate material. As dimensioned stone, marble has been most notably used in the construction architectural design elements. From sculptures and monuments to flooring, walls, countertops, basins, fountains, and even entire buildings, marble has been widely applied. Some famous examples are be the Statue of David (by Michelangelo), the Taj Mahal (Agra, India), the Washington Monument (Washington D.C., USA), and the Pantheon (Rome, Italy).

 

As an aggregate material such as crushed stone chips, marble can be used in construction and landscaping for foundations, rock gardens, roads and pathways due to being resistant to weathering, and found not to harbour pests or allergens. Additionally, when ground into a powder, marble is used within the agricultural sector to neutralize acidic soils (when heated into calcium oxide) and incorporated into animal feed as a nutrient calcium source. Ground marble has also been used as a standard acid neutralizing agent in the chemical industry and healthcare (e.g., antacids), as a material whitener (e.g., paints, paper, pastes), and as a mild abrasive in cleaning or scrubbing products.
